Etna Comics 2026 Is About to Take Over Catania — And Here's Why You Can't Miss It

Remember when being into anime, comics, and cosplay made you the weird kid?

 

Yeah, those days are LONG gone.

 

Now Catania is about to become the coolest place in Italy — and it's all happening at Etna Comics 2026.

 

From May 30 to June 2, over 100,000 fans will flood into Le Ciminiere exhibition center for four days of pure pop culture madness.

 

And this isn't some small-town comic swap meet.

 

This is the 14th edition of what has become Italy's largest pop culture festival in the south — and it's right here in our backyard.

 

So What's Actually Going Down?

 

Picture this.

 

45,000 square meters of indoor and outdoor space packed with everything your inner geek could dream of.

 

We're talking comics, anime, manga, gaming tournaments, cosplay competitions, live music, artist panels, workshops, and meet-and-greets with international stars.

 

The guest list this year is absolutely stacked.

 

Leo Ortolani — one of Italy's most beloved cartoonists — will be there.

 

Caparezza, the legendary Italian musician known for his razor-sharp lyrics, is performing.

 

And here's the big one: Yōichi Takahashi, the manga creator behind Holly e Benji (known worldwide as Captain Tsubasa), is flying in from Japan.

 

Let that sink in.

 

The guy who created one of the most iconic sports manga of all time will be signing autographs right here in Catania.

How to Experience It

 

First things first — get your tickets early.

 

This thing sells out.

 

Head to etnacomics.com and grab yours before they're gone.

 

If you're local, consider booking that week off work or at least clearing your weekend.

 

The festival runs Friday through Monday, with different events and panels each day.

 

Pro tip: Download the official app (if available) or follow their socials for the schedule.

 

Some of the biggest panels and meet-and-greets require separate tickets or early arrival — don't be that person showing up 10 minutes late and missing out.
